Output 66da7effa24f52b5d2a4b606dbfee8a772c40e7ffb5ebb29309d16aa6764e5c5:0

value
267800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5cb1c8a4d885e5f729ab7e4e7f8ad837e298a7 OP_EQUALVERIFY OP_CHECKSIG
address
1JSq7AXBhRwMMSEassKaH9T2r7U4mKs132
transaction
66da7effa24f52b5d2a4b606dbfee8a772c40e7ffb5ebb29309d16aa6764e5c5
spent
true